6.11 Disassembly and welding of various components
6.11.1. Disassembly and welding of small components:
6.11.1.1 Disassembly temperature: According to the Reference Standard for Welding Temperature of Various Types of Components, the temperature of the heat gun should be 340℃ ~ 360℃, and the temperature of the heating table should be 200℃ ~ 220℃
6.11.1.2 Disassembly requirements; First apply a small amount of flux to the component to be removed. Choose the air nozzle of the hot air gun. At the same time, the heating table can also be selected for auxiliary heating at the bottom. The hot air gun is evenly heated along the small components. After the solder melts, remove the element with tweezers.
6.11.1.3 Welding temperature: According to the Reference Standard for Welding Temperature of Various Types of Components, the temperature of the heat gun shall be 340℃ ~ 360℃, and the temperature of the heating table shall be 200℃ ~ 220℃
6.11.1.4 Welding requirements: Before welding the small components, confirm the position and direction of the components to avoid the wrong position and direction during refueling. Add a small amount of flux to the pad of the small components to be welded. If the solder on the pad is insufficient, use electric soldering iron to add a little solder on the pad. Also can point a little tin paste. Choose the air nozzle of the hot air gun, and the heating table can also be selected for auxiliary heating at the bottom. The hot air gun is first heated on the pad from far to far. When the tin of the pad melts, use tweezers to clamp the welding components and place them to the corresponding position
Place, pay attention to the direction of the component to the good direction and put right, until the welding end of the component and the pad are completely melted, welded together.
6.11.1.5 Precautions for disassembly and welding: Pay attention to the protection of surrounding components, especially plastic components, and do not blow out or deformation. No discoloration, burning and burning of components after maintenance, to ensure the weldability of components, maintenance area and surrounding components can not be displaced. Fake welding. Even tin and other undesirable phenomena, the back can not appear to wipe plate, dropped parts, displacement and other phenomena.
